Types of Welding Helmets
I discovered that there are mainly two types of welding helmets: passive and auto-darkening. Passive helmets have a fixed shade and require me to lift the helmet to see clearly when not welding. On the other hand, auto-darkening helmets automatically adjust the lens shade based on the intensity of the light, making it easier for me to switch between tasks without lifting the helmet.

Comfort and Fit
I’ve learned that comfort is crucial when selecting a welding helmet. A well-fitted helmet should not be too heavy, as this can lead to neck strain over time. Adjustable straps and padding make a significant difference in comfort levels, allowing me to wear the helmet for extended periods without discomfort.
Lens Quality and Protection
The lens quality is another factor I pay attention to. I prefer helmets with high-quality auto-darkening lenses that provide clear visibility and quick response times. Additionally, I always check for UV and IR protection ratings to ensure my eyes are well-protected from harmful rays.
Battery Life and Power Options
Battery life is essential for me, especially during long welding sessions. I often look for helmets with solar power options combined with replaceable batteries. This way, I can ensure that my helmet stays operational without interruptions.
